Your AI-Ready Content Stack

Rule of thumb: Write for humans, as an impartial expert, about why you’re the obvious choice — no corporate kabuki.

  1. Best-Fit Briefs – Hyper-specific Q&A mini-posts (“Who’s the best [service] in [city]?”).

  2. Top Reasons Series – One punch-list per service showcasing benefits, proof, price clarity.

  3. Service–City Combos – Spreadsheet every service–location pair; short third-person blurbs.

  4. Comparison Pages – You vs. 3–5 rivals, category by category, where you legitimately win (no lying!)

  5. Conversion Staples – FAQ, Case Studies, Testimonials, Pricing. Hide nothing; trust wins.

Off-Page Signals: Mentions Better than Links

  • Claim every profile (Google Business, BBB, LinkedIn, niche directories). A tool like Yext can shotgun your info everywhere.

  • Review Blitz – Yelp is a necessary evil; ask happy clients, ignore the sales calls.

Quick-Start Checklist

  1. Draft five Best-Fit Briefs this week.

  2. Spin up a Top Reasons post for each service.

  3. Flesh out FAQ, Testimonials, Pricing (no gate-keeping).

  4. Claim/complete every directory profile—block 90 minutes, cue caffeine.

  5. Schedule a monthly “review ask” to loyal clients.
